Body

Origins and Family

Recorded date of birth include September 13, 1267[2] and 1267[5]. Ludwig of Bavaria's father was Louis II, Duke of Bavaria[7]. His mother was Anna of Glogau[8].

Personal Life

Spouses include Isabelle of Lorraine[9], an aristocrat[18], 1272–1335[19].

Death and Burial

Recorded date of death include November 23, 1290[4] and 1290[6]. Ludwig of Bavaria died in Nuremberg[3].
